Three peaks before breakfast? That might not be possible (let alone pleasant) but the paths to two of the famed Yorkshire Three Peaks start less than five minutes' drive away from this quiet site on a family-run hill farm in the Yorkshire Dales. Philpin Farm is a 10-minute drive from Ingleton and the Ribblehead Viaduct, on the route of the Settle-Carlisle Railway. The site is small and two-tiered, with accommodation areas at the bottom and top of a small hill (the car park is near the top area as no cars are allowed on the field). The farm's barn is available for eating and mingling in, and it's home to a snack bar on weekends; you can also order cooked breakfasts and packed lunches, buy homemade cakes, even socks, gloves, hats and rain ponchos if you've come under-prepared. The barn also has vending machines that are open 24 hours per day, so that's your midnight snack sorted. Barbecues are allowed on site if raised off the ground (strictly no fires). The only other strict rule is the farm's no-noise policy at night: please let everyone savour the peace of this very special place. There's a welcoming 17th-century inn five minutes' walk away, more of the same, plus shops and a chip shop in Ingleton.

Local attractions

For committed peak baggers, trails up to Ingleborough and Whernside run just by the farm, and the starting point for third peak, Pen-y-ghent, is 15 minutes' drive away. While some mark off their scorecards and leave, others stay and explore this area stuffed with wonders both natural and man-made. The Settle-Carlisle Railway, and its transit over the mighty Ribblehead Viaduct, marks a meeting of human endeavour and landscape: don't miss a chance to take one of the world's great rides: 73 miles through remote and sometimes jaw-dropping scenery from Ribblehead, five minutes' drive away, or Settle (half an hour). If you're up for something more active, it's 10 minutes into Ingleton for tours of the White Scar Caves and the trail to the waterfalls. Heading further westwards towards the Forest of Bowland, it's a 45-minute drive to paths up Bowland's highest point, White Hill for views of Dales, Lakes and even sometimes, the sea. The area is popular with cyclists, too, with numerous bike routes through Gisburn Forest starting from the Forest Hub café, also 45 minutes away. If water's more your element, it's half an hour to Semer Water for coarse and brown trout fishing, canoeing and windsurfing and if you're a tad peckish after all that outdoor stuff you could head up to Hawes (20 minutes) and sample the cheesy delights of the Wensleydale Creamery.
